Podcast #15 Swing and Sophistication

Hi all, Welcome to my latest podcast...1940s recordings from 78s in my collection. Here are the tunes in the show: 1. FELIX MENDELSSOHN AND HIS HAWAIIAN SERENADERS - WHISPERING (from COLUMBIA FB 2798, recorded circa 20th December 1941) 2. AMBROSE AND HIS ORCHESTRA - DOWN ARGENTINA WAY (from DECCA F.7703, recorded on 17th January 1941) 3. BILLY COTTON AND HIS BAND - HEARTS DON'T LIE (from REX 10038, recorded on 8th September 1941) 4. CARROLL GIBBONS AND THE SAVOY HOTEL ORPHEANS - I DON'T WANT TO WALK WITHOUT YOU (from COLUMBIA FB 2799, recorded on 11th May 1942) 5. JOE LOSS AND HIS ORCHESTRA - CORNSILK (from HMV BD 5707, recorded on 21st September 1941) 6. SAM BROWNE - NIGHT AND DAY (from HMV BD 874, recorded circa 10th May 1940) 7. GERALDO AND HIS ORCHESTRA - IDAHO (from PARLOPHONE F1949, recorded on 15th October 1942) 8. ERIC WINSTONE AND HIS BAND - DANCE WITH A DOLLY (from HMV BD 5866, recorded on 10th November 1944) 9. PAUL FENOULHET WITH THE SKYROCKETS DANCE ORCHESTRA - CEMENT MIXER (from HMV BD 5943, recorded circa 1st April 1946) 10. ROBERTO INGLEZ AND HIS ORCHESTRA - TICO TICO (from PARLOPHONE F2207, recorded circa 15th December 1946) ENJOY!
